    Zero-Knowledge Identity Verification for Robotics

    Autonomous machines can now verify they are interacting with real, unique humans without collecting names, faces or other personal details, following an integration between PeaqOS and World ID. The update, available through robotic.sh, allows connected machines to request and validate World ID proofs natively.

    According to a media statement, the system uses zero-knowledge technology, enabling a person to confirm they are human while keeping their identity private.

    As delivery robots, shared machines and autonomous systems interact directly with people, operators face a challenge: confirming that a user is legitimate without relying on PINs, pickup codes or identity documents. Codes can be stolen or shared, and traditional identity checks often require collecting personal information.

    World ID offers an alternative. Instead of receiving a person’s identity, the machine receives a cryptographic proof that the user is a real human. PeaqOS acts as the coordination layer, enabling machines to use World ID through decentralized identifiers and the machine market. A robot can request verification, receive the zero-knowledge proof and log an auditable record of the interaction — all without exposing underlying identity data.

    The system also supports uniqueness checks, allowing machines to enforce rules such as “one item per human” without maintaining databases of user identities.

    One demonstration highlights autonomous medication delivery. A patient verifies through World App before an order is accepted. At the pharmacy, the pharmacist verifies before loading the medication. When the robot arrives at its destination, the patient verifies again, allowing the robot to confirm the recipient is the same human associated with the order before unlocking its compartment.

    Promotional distribution robots could similarly ensure each person receives only one item. Shared machines could grant access to verified humans without requiring account creation or personal data collection.

    World ID support is live for robots and machines running PeaqOS via robotic.sh. The integration gives autonomous systems a way to confirm they are interacting with real humans while minimizing the identity information they receive or store.
